Description
Discharge of conditions 3 (Construction Traffic Management), 4 (Archaeological monitoring and recording), 6 (Ecology - CEMP) and 7 (Soakaways) on planning application P24/S2478/FUL (The extension of the existing substation to accommodate additional electrical supply infrastructure, such as a new transformer, new gantry, new switch building and ancillary development hitherto).
